Output 595a33ef29de3323655a5f6f253cf5c21c3a5797526ae9f676aa8891d5f27684:2

value
881848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296ee3dcf5c1c7a9c917365c1098b7a0bc88d583 OP_EQUAL
address
35U6UBpW7DGFbUSRYMtKqPMaxeW8RzgC2Q
transaction
595a33ef29de3323655a5f6f253cf5c21c3a5797526ae9f676aa8891d5f27684
spent
true